The cold bites the back of your throat the moment you step out into the dawn air above the Bow River. What looks in photographs like milky turquoise paint is, up close, crushed rock flour suspended in freezing glacial melt. Above the water stands Mount Victoria, silent and enormous. You share the gravel path with park wardens, bleary-eyed day hikers lacing boots, and the occasional red fox cutting across the scree. Lake Louise is worth visiting if you want to climb above the treeline for hot tea at alpine cabins and hike through glacier-carved granite valleys.

What to do in Lake Louise Alberta Canada

Life here centres on the water and the sheer vertical relief of the Bow Valley. The compact lower village handles the practicalities, while the lakefront above holds the trailheads. It suits hikers who do not mind an early alarm, skiers chasing dry Rockies powder, and anyone willing to walk twenty minutes past the shoreline crowds to find real mountain silence.

24 hours in Lake Louise Alberta Canada

Catch the sunrise shuttle to the lake before the parking lots choke. Hike the 3.6-kilometre trail up to Lake Agnes Tea House for hot tea and a slice of bread. Spend the afternoon canoeing the shoreline, then finish with Alberta braised elk at the historic 1910 railway station in the lower village. Select 1 Day above to see it.

2 days in Lake Louise Alberta Canada

Day two belongs to the Highline Trail linking Lake Agnes to the Plain of Six Glaciers, where massive ice falls rumble in the distance. Descend for a restorative bowl of bison chili and a local craft ale at the Lake Louise village square, resting sore knees after fifteen kilometres on foot. Choose 2 Days to expand the plan.

3 days in Lake Louise Alberta Canada

Take the third morning to head twenty minutes east to Johnston Canyon or drive north along the Icefields Parkway to Bow Lake. Pack layers, grab coffee and fresh pastries at Laggan's Deli, and spend a quiet afternoon spotting wildlife along the Moraine Lake Road or the Pipestone valley.
